What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Internship Butler,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Internship Butler, you need excellent organizational skills, attention to detail, and prior experience in hospitality or customer service, often supported by relevant training or coursework. Familiarity with property management systems, booking software, and communication tools is typically required. Outstanding interpersonal skills, discretion, and the ability to anticipate client needs set exceptional candidates apart. These competencies are crucial for delivering seamless, personalized service and maintaining high standards in luxury hospitality environments.

What are the typical responsibilities and learning opportunities for an Internship Butler within a hospitality team?

As an Internship Butler, you will typically assist senior butlers and hospitality staff in delivering personalized guest services, managing guest requests, and maintaining high standards of service. Your daily tasks may include preparing guest rooms, assisting with luggage, coordinating guest schedules, and responding to special requests. This role offers valuable exposure to luxury service protocols, teamwork, and guest relations, providing a solid foundation for advancing within the hospitality industry. You will also have opportunities to learn from experienced professionals and develop skills essential for future roles in guest services or management.
